I watched as he strode away, down the street. As he passed a flickering streetlight, I said more to myself than to him ",Goodnight."
Things were over, much to my dismay. He was the one



I was in a panic. It was my wedding day and also the end of my real life. I dragged my feet up down the hall, as I walked to open a letter I had just found in a recently delivered bouquet of flowers. As I took a seat, I noticed how familiar the writing of my name was to me.
"KARREN! WHERE ARE YOU, DEAR? WHY AREN'T YOU IN YOUR DRESS YET?! YOU HAVE 20 MINUTES BEFORE YOU HAVE TO BE OUT THERE," my mother screached down the halls of the cathedral.
I, however, was preoccupied. I sat, a chill running through my spinal chord. In my hand, I held a letter in which he bore out his soul to me.
Kare-bear;
I understand that I screwed up how and why things took a turn towards the worst for us. We used to compliment eachother like colors; we had everything going great for us.
I can't stand watching you in your faulty relationship as you make the biggest mistake of your life, as well as mine by not stopping you. Come back with me to the days when we both fit?
Back then, stars were brighter and seemed more so with every passing day. Now as I look up to the sky each and every night, while thinking of you, they seem dimmer with each and every passing second.
I'm done waiting for God's new plans; I've gone astray. I can see now that I rushed things, but will take things slower this time.
I promise.
Everyone deserves a second chance, agreed? Better late than never. I'm sorry.
Love,
Donnie

I thought that getting married would help me move on, but I was way wrong.
I ran through the halls, while realizing I was to be out at the alter in no more than 11 minutes. I raced down the stairs of the church after bursting through the enterance doors. I slowed at the stairs' end and stopped at the curb, where I found Donnie on his motorcycle. I smiled as my heart rate increaced.
"I didn't think you'd come," he said, softly.
"I didn't think you'd ask me to," I replied.
"What makes you so sure I've changed," he asked, not convinced.
"Everyone deserves a second chance," and with that, I hopped onto the motorcycle and held on tightly, as he drove down the street with speed and acceleration.
We still complimented eachother like colors in harmony; we made eachother look brighter like we did in the start.
